It is possible to add locks to the storage compartment in the beds!
1 remove old latch assemblies
2 drill door hole out to 5/8 to fit a 5/8 lock assembly!
3 install lock.
4 bend the the latch mechanism outward away from the door just alittle bit!
5 make the slot in the compartment just a alittle bit bigger so the lock will sit in it. (I used a Dremel)
6 install door and test fitment until perfect!
